    <![CDATA[<strong>Author:</strong> <a href="https://www.rpod-owners.com/member_profile.asp?PF=4814" rel="nofollow">StephenH</a><br /><strong>Subject:</strong> 16167<br /><strong>Posted:</strong> 19 Apr 2025 at 11:03pm<br /><br />I ended up doing most of the cooking outside because of the smoke detector. As you note, there is no vent above the stove. While we no longer have the RPod, the Cherokee Grey Wolf is only marginally better. It has a vent hood, but a weak fan and it will still set the smoke detector off if I try to do anything that generates smoke. So, I still do the grilling and frying outside. I started to take the smoke detector down and cover it with a pillow until after I am done cooking. After all, if it is pouring outside and I can't cook outside, we still need to eat.]]>
